More than a service — a genuine partnership
Autism Support Hub was founded in 2022 with a simple but powerful mission: to ensure autistic children, teens and young adults receive the structured, proactive and compassionate support they need to thrive across all areas of life.
We combine clinical expertise with genuine understanding, delivering services that work collaboratively with families, schools, employers and support teams to create consistent, sustainable outcomes.
We believe successful transitions don't happen by accident — they are planned, supported and skill-built over time. That philosophy drives everything we do.
